Internship Experience:
- Developing, maintaining, monitoring, and supporting automation facilities, web services, and tools to enhance CI/CD flows and pipelines
- Managing and optimizing web-services such as Jenkins, JFrog Artifactory, shared databases, and file repositories.
- Collaborating with R&D teams to implement efficient automated building, regression testing, deployment, advanced reports, and benchmarks.
- Providing support and automation consulting to users across multiple global sites.
- Ensuring the continuous integration ecosystem supports various CI flows for Synopsys ARC products.
- Utilizing your scripting and web-development skills to streamline automation processes.
What You'll Need:
- Currently pursuing an engineering or master's degree in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, or a related field.
- Knowledge of build/test automation tools (Jenkins pipeline, GitLab CI).
- Understanding of scripting languages such as Python, Bash, or Groovy.
- Experience with web-development languages (PHP is a preference).
- Familiarity with build tools (make, CMake, Ninja).
- Skills in source code management tools (Git is required; Perforce is a plus).
- User experience with Unix/Linux environments.
- Knowledge of DevOps and CI/CD web-services and tools (e.g., Artifactory, Ansible, Grafana, Docker).
- Strong verbal and written English communication skills.
